Description
Hat Springs Ranch, a sprawling 4,440-acre property situated on the Utah-Idaho border near Malta, Idaho, presents a unique opportunity for agricultural and recreational pursuits. This working cattle and horse ranch boasts 1,600 acres of deeded land and 2,800 acres leased from the State of Idaho, offering a diverse landscape encompassing irrigated pastures, grazing land, and the foothills of the Raft River and Bally Mountains. The ranch features two feedlots with a capacity exceeding 900 head of cattle, supported by a gravity-fed water system originating from three year-round springs. Approximately 350 acres are currently under irrigation using pivots and hand lines, yielding over 3 tons of alfalfa per acre and even higher yields for grass mixes. The property includes extensive fencing (excluding a portion of a southern hillside), equipment sheds, cattle chutes, pens, corrals, and walk-in/tack sheds for horses. The ranch has historically supported up to 600 head of cattle during winter months. The diverse terrain provides excellent hunting opportunities, with abundant wildlife including mule deer, mountain lion, elk, turkey, and grouse, and direct access to the USFS. Recreational activities such as mountain biking, backpacking, fishing, camping, ATVing, and horseback riding are readily available. Recent improvements include new cross-fencing and a shed for processing pasture-raised beef, along with ongoing improvements to increase stocking rates on the upper 350 acres of pasture. The property is conveniently located within a pleasant drive of Salt Lake City. The asking price is $4,950,000.
